HOLDIN
Holden, Holdyne, Howeldin

One of Arthur’s nobles, to whom Arthur gave either Flanders (in Geoffrey of Monmouth) or Boulogne (in Wace). Holdin assisted Arthur in the Roman war. He led a company at the Battle of Soissons, where he and King Alifatma of Spain mortally wounded each other. Arthur had him buried in his city of Thérouanne or Tervanna. In the Prose Brut, he is Arthur’s chamberlain. Thomas Bek calls him the “King of the Ruteni.”
